In this Yuet Sing Seafood, the owner’s first top recommended in menus surely will be their best Signature Curry Fish Head. Commonly deep sea red fish head selected, cooked with chef’s in-house curry paste made from more than 10 ingredients mixture, added into lady finger, eggplant, cabbage and dried beancurd, then finally served boiled in claypot brings authentic light spicy and exotic curry taste into mouth you must try when reached Singapore.
Secondly will be among their daily top seller wanted by most of the visitors, the Salted Egg Yolk Pork Ribs (or chicken). Fresh pork ribs (or chicken) marinated with home recipes, deep fried to hold the meat’s juicy, then stir-fried seconds with homemade salted egg yolk paste brings excellent crispy bites into mouth, and also brings sweet and fair salty taste you will never regret after tasted in this Yuet Sing Seafood.
Another will be their Claypot Glass Noodles with Crab, will be neither found better elsewhere in town. Imported meat-crabs from Sri Lanka being selected, with about average 700 grams in weight stir-cooked with black pepper, then stewed minutes in claypot with glass noodles added into ginger slices, onions and chef’s recipe sauce brings exotic pepper spicy taste you cannot aside.
Nonetheless, the owners Sandy and Hong Siang also taken the opportunity to strongly introduce their Four Treasure Beancurd which best recommended to their regular visitors. Homemade beancurd from mixtures of squid paste, japanese soy milk beancurd and chinese smoked sausage cubes deep fried, then served topped with mushroom, fresh scallop, prawn and abalone clams meat sided with broccoli veges you cannot missed when stepped into this “Yuet Sing Seafood” restaurant at Chinatown Food Street, Singapore.
